Starting in 2019, we had three years of double digit growth at our State WB matches, then all the rule change rumblings started and we've been down shooters ever since. I know this is localized data, but it is consistent in the adjacent state matches I've shot. Winter Range/EOT sold out every year even with an ever increasing cap until last year. For the past two years, it has not filled up.
